What is an AI Stock Trading Bot?
An AI stock trading bot is advanced software that uses artificial intelligence to analyze stock markets.
These bots process large amounts of data from sources like price charts, news articles, and social media trends. By dissecting these factors, the bot can identify patterns and potential price movements, allowing it to make informed trading decisions.
The algorithms used in these bots are incredibly intricate and follow a set of rules and guidelines that enable the bots to analyze and interpret market data accurately. Also, they can continuously learn and adapt to new market trends by utilizing machine learning and deep learning techniques, making them highly efficient and effective.
Moreover, these bots can execute trades autonomously, empowering you with the control over your trading decisions. This not only saves time but also removes the possibility of emotional decisions, which can lead to losses in the volatile world of stock trading.
The exact percentage of people who consistently win in the stock market using trading bots varies widely and is difficult to pin down precisely, due to factors like the bot’s quality, market conditions, user strategy, and risk management. However, here’s a realistic perspective based on industry insights:
Most studies and expert opinions suggest that only about 10% to 30% of traders using algorithmic or AI trading bots achieve consistent profitability over time. While bots can process data faster and remove emotional bias, the stock market’s inherent volatility and unpredictability mean that no bot guarantees success.
Some key points to consider:
Bots excel at speed and executing predefined strategies but can struggle in unexpected market scenarios.
Profitability often depends on how well the user configures and adapts the bot, not just on the bot itself.
Around 70% of total trading volume in markets like the US is driven by algorithms, but that doesn’t translate directly to individual trader success.
Many traders use bots for part of their strategy combined with human oversight.
So, while trading bots can improve efficiency and reduce emotional mistakes, their success rate in terms of consistent winning traders remains moderate. Success usually requires ongoing optimization, risk management, and market knowledge.
3 Advantages and Disadvantages of Algorithmic Assistance
AI stock trading bots offer a host of advantages that can significantly enhance your trading strategy. Here are some key benefits that make them a compelling option :
Speed and Efficiency: AI bots can analyze vast amounts of data and execute trades at lightning speed, far surpassing what humans can do. This allows them to capitalize on fleeting market opportunities that a slower human trader might miss.
Emotionless Decisions: Human emotions like fear or greed can cloud judgment and lead to costly investment mistakes. AI bots, however, make decisions based on cold, hard data, eliminating the influence of emotions entirely.
24/7 Market Coverage: The stock market never sleeps, and neither do AI bots. They can monitor the market around the clock, allowing you to capitalize on potential opportunities even while you're away from the screen.
In facts, roughly 70% of the total trading volume is driven by algorithmic trading in the US. Another survey shows that traders who use this tatics increases their productivity by 10%.
💡 But, does this kind of stock trading assisstant have dark side?
The answer is yes. From most of user's perspectives, it's not all roses because:
Hard to Set Up: Building an AI trading bot up and running isn’t easy. You need some serious tech skills, like programming and understanding how AI works, about machine learning algorithms, which can be daunting for many.
Risk of Scams: Not all AI bots are trustworthy. Some are outright scams, and it’s easy to get fooled if you’re not careful.
Unpredictable Markets: Even if a bot works great in tests, it doesn’t mean it’ll do well in real life. Markets change, and you’ll need to tweak your strategy constantly.
In summary, AI bots can help you stay ahead of the game in the fast-paced stock market by providing you with speedy and efficient trading, emotionless decision-making, and 24/7 market coverage. By the way, be careful on choosing your trusted ones.

A Quick Note on "Free": Understanding the Models
In the world of financial tech, "free" can mean different things. This list includes all types so you can find the right fit:
Free Trial: You get full access to premium features for a limited time (e.g., 7 or 14 days) before you must pay.
Freemium (Free Tier): A 100% free plan is available forever, but it has significant limitations (e.g., fewer bots, ad-support, limited backtests, or slower data).
Open-Source: The software is completely free to download, use, and modify. This is the "freest" option but requires technical skills to install and run.
Paid Only: Some platforms are included because they are industry leaders, but they do not offer any free plan, only a paid subscription.

2. Superalgos: Visualize Your Trading Strategy
Best For: Developers & tech-savvy users who want a 100% free, open-source platform.
Key Broker Integrations:Cryptocurrency Exchanges only. Connects via API (using the CCXT library) to dozens of exchanges like Binance, Kraken, KuCoin, OKEx, and Bitfinex. It does not support traditional stock brokers.
Superalgos is an open-source platform that provides a powerful entry point for individuals who want to harness AI without any cost. With its visual development environment, it is highly flexible but requires technical skills to install and run on your own machine.
Key features:
Built-in charting and backtesting
Visual, node-based strategy designer
Full control over your data and strategies (you run it locally)
Pricing & Free Model: Completely free to download and use as it is open-source.

5. TradingView: Scripting for Advanced Technical Analysis
Best For: Technical analysts and chartists at all levels.
Platforms: Web, Desktop (Windows/Mac/Linux), Mobile (iOS & Android)
Pricing Model: Freemium
Key Broker Integrations (Verified): A large and growing list. For stocks/futures: Interactive Brokers, Alpaca, TradeStation, Webull, Tradier. For Forex/CFD: OANDA, FXCM, and many more.
TradingView is the most popular platform for technical analysis and charting. While not a "bot" platform by default, its "Pine Script" language allows you to create custom trading alerts and strategies. You can automate these alerts to execute trades on a connected broker.
Key features:
Deep market screening capabilities
Best-in-class chart types and 100+ technical indicators
A massive community sharing scripts and ideas
Pricing & Free Model:
Offers a robust free plan (ad-supported, 3 indicators per chart).
Paid plans (starting at $12.95/month) remove ads and add more indicators, alerts, and broker connections.

10. QuantConnect
QuantConnect is a comprehensive algorithmic trading platform designed for quants, developers, and traders to create, backtest, and deploy trading strategies across multiple asset classes and global markets. It offers a cloud-based environment that supports multiple programming languages including C#, Python, and F#. The platform integrates with various brokerages for live trading and provides access to a rich historical data library for thorough backtesting.
Key features:
Multi-Asset Support: Trade stocks, options, futures, forex, and cryptocurrencies all within one platform.
Cloud-Based IDE: Code, backtest, and optimize strategies entirely online without worrying about local setup.
Algorithm Backtesting: Access to extensive historical market data to rigorously test trading algorithms before deployment.
Multi-Language Support: Primarily supports C# and Python, catering to both traditional developers and data scientists.
Brokerage Integrations: Supports live trading with popular brokers like Interactive Brokers, FXCM, and Tradier.
QuantConnect offers a free tier. There's a paid subscription starting from around $8/month, depending on the plan.
Exploring Different Types of AI Stock Trading Bots
There are several categories of AI bots that can be used for trading, each with its own unique strengths and weaknesses. Let's take a closer look at some of the most common ones:
Technical Analysis Bots: These are designed to recognize trading signals by analyzing historical price trends and technical indicators such as moving averages and relative strength indexes (RSI).
Fundamental Analysis Bots: These examine company fundamentals such as earnings reports, news sentiment analysis, and industry trends to make investment decisions.
Hybrid Bots: These combine elements of both technical and fundamental analysis to create a more comprehensive trading strategy. This multi-faceted approach can result in better-informed decisions.

Can AI Trading Bots Destabilize the Market?
Not quite — but AI trading bots can shake things up in the short term. That’s been keeping both Wall Street pros and computer scientists up at night. Let’s break it down:
AI trading bots are designed to analyze data and make decisions at lightning speed. That’s great for spotting opportunities, but it also means they can all react to the same piece of news — or each other — in a split second. When that happens, it can trigger rapid price swings or even cause temporary sell-offs. We’ve seen glimpses of this before, like during the 2010 Flash Crash, when automated trading led to a massive drop and rebound within minutes.
But will AI trading bots break the entire system?
Unlikely. The market has built-in guardrails, like circuit breakers and oversight from regulators. Plus, not all bots follow the same logic — many use different data, different strategies, and even compete with each other. That kind of diversity actually helps stabilize the bigger picture.
At the end of the day, AI bots are just another step in the evolution of trading. They’re powerful tools — and when used with a solid strategy, they can be game-changers. The key is knowing what you’re using and why.

Q3. Is it legal to use AI to trade stocks?
Yes, using AI to trade stocks is legal as long as it complies with financial regulations and does not involve illegal activities like market manipulation or insider trading. Always check with your broker for their policies on automated trading.
